Belwa in context

With 2,171 people at the 2011 Census, Belwa was the 467th most populous of its district's 1262 villages, above the district average of 2,021.

Literacy stood at 70.69%, 8.8 points above the district's rural average of 61.91%.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1128, 205 above the rural national 923.
